Emergency Room Registered Nurse (ER RN)
Facility: University of Maryland Capital Region Medical Center
Location: 901 Harry S Truman Dr N, Largo, MD 20774
Unit: Emergency Room (46-bed Level II Trauma Center)
Contract Duration: 13 weeks
Start Date: 08/25/2025 (or ASAP)
Shift Options: Night Shift: 3x12-Hour (19:30–08:00)
Weekend Requirement: Every Other Weekend
Job Overview
Seeking experienced ER RNs for a high-volume (140 daily visits) Level II Trauma Center. Must thrive in fast-paced environments managing diverse cases—from trauma to pediatric emergencies. 3+ years of ER experience required; travel experience preferred.
